# NAME
**tss2_encrypt**(1) - encrypts data
# SYNOPSIS
**tss2_encrypt** [*OPTIONS*]

# DESCRIPTION
**tss2_encrypt**(1) - This command encrypts the provided data for a target key
using the TPM encryption schemes as specified in the cryptographic profile
(cf., **fapi-profile(5)**).
# OPTIONS
These are the available options:
* **-p**, **\--keyPath**=_STRING_:
Identifies the encryption key.
* **-f**, **\--force**:
Force overwriting the output file.
* **-i**, **\--plainText**=_FILENAME_ or _-_ (for stdin):
The data to be encrypted.
* **-o**, **\--cipherText**=_FILENAME_ or _-_ (for stdout):
Returns the JSON-encoded ciphertext.

# EXAMPLE
```
tss2_encrypt --keyPath=HS/SRK/myRSACrypt --plainText=plainText.file --cipherText=cipherText.file
```
# RETURNS
0 on success or 1 on failure.
